Loft Orbital is seeking a skilled Production Planning Lead to drive key processes that will ensure efficient material planning, scheduling, and production across our operations. In this role, you will help optimize our manufacturing processes while working cross-functionally to meet our growing demand.
As the Production Planning Lead, you will be responsible for establishing, maintaining, and improving our Material Requirements Planning (MRP) system. You’ll work across teams—Engineering, Operations, Supply Chain, and Programs—to create and manage production schedules, oversee material procurement, and ensure production efficiency. Your deep expertise will be critical to scaling our production capabilities while maintaining consistency and ensuring material traceability across all programs.

About this Role:
- Lead the development and maintenance of production scheduling and MRP processes, ensuring alignment across all teams.
- Synthesize inputs from cross-functional teams to generate and maintain the Master Production Schedule (MPS) that supports emerging and contractual demands.
- Coordinate workload across multiple programs, ensuring timely release of material requests, and prioritizing based on production needs.
- Support the development and growth of fellow planners, fostering team collaboration and ensuring collective success.
- Manage material demand integrity for components and subassemblies within the ERP system, driving procurement and production schedules.
- Maintain and update MRP system data, ensuring alignment with engineering BOMs and proper account assignment settings for stock items.
- Proactively identify and resolve potential issues with production schedules, supply chain bottlenecks, or work center capacities.
- Provide regular reports on production efficiency, inventory status, schedule risks, and material forecasts to senior leadership and stakeholders.

Who We Are
Loft Orbital builds “shareable” satellites, providing a fast & simple path to orbit for organizations that require access to space. Powered by our hardware & software products, we operate satellites, fly customer payloads onboard, and handle entire missions from end to end - significantly reducing the lead-time and risk of a traditional space mission.
Our standard interface enables us to fly multiple customer payloads on the same satellite, with capabilities such as earth imagery, weather & climate /science data collection, IoT connectivity, in-orbit demonstrations, and national security missions. Our customers trust us to manage their space infrastructure, so they can focus on what matters most to them: operating their mission and collecting their data.
